

Hydraulic fracturing, the technique used for the production of oil and natural gas, uses frac pumps to transmit the fracking fluid into the wellbore. Each frac fleet uses several frac pumps. Typically, 18-20 frac pumps are used per frac fleet. These pumps consist of two major components, the power end and the fluid end.
The global Hydraulic Fracturing Fluid End market is projected to reach US$ 1150.6 million in 2029, increasing from US$ 723 million in 2022, with the CAGR of 6.9% during the period of 2023 to 2029. Oil prices have experienced significant volatility in recent years. Factors such as geopolitical tensions, global supply-demand dynamics, production cuts, and economic conditions impact oil prices. The COVID-19 pandemic, in particular, caused a sharp decline in demand and prices, followed by a gradual recovery as economies reopen and demand picks up. The global energy landscape is undergoing a transition towards cleaner and more sustainable sources of energy. This transition is driven by factors such as climate change concerns, renewable energy advancements, and government policies promoting decarbonization. Oil and gas companies are increasingly diversifying their portfolios to include renewable energy sources and investing in low-carbon technologies. Oil and gas companies are focusing on improving operational efficiency and reducing costs. Technologies such as data analytics, artificial intelligence, and automation are being employed to optimize production, enhance asset performance, and streamline operations. Energy efficiency measures are also being adopted to reduce environmental impact and improve sustainability.
